VHS domain of human GGA1 complexed with C-terminal phosphopeptide from BACE

Template:ABSTRACT PUBMED 15117318

About this Structure

1UJK is a 4 chains structure of sequences from Homo sapiens. Full crystallographic information is available from OCA.

Reference

  • Shiba T, Kametaka S, Kawasaki M, Shibata M, Waguri S, Uchiyama Y, Wakatsuki S. Insights into the phosphoregulation of beta-secretase sorting signal by the VHS domain of GGA1. Traffic. 2004 Jun;5(6):437-48. PMID:15117318 doi:10.1111/j.1600-0854.2004.00188.x
